Abstract
To achieve frequency separation between actuators of a dual-stageservo actuator system in a hard disk drive, the PQ control designmethod can be used. In the PQ method, the servo controller isdesigned by focusing on structural interference of the actuators.This paper provides a specific parametrization for fixed orderfeedback controllers used in the PQ-method for which thestructural interference between actuators can be minimized. Theproposed control design method is applied to a dual-stageinstrumented suspension, where the additional sensor of theinstrumented suspension is used to attenuate high frequencydisturbance caused by windage turbulence in a hard disk drive.
